Problems solved by technology

And the ultimate load of the binder is low, generally around 64.8N, resulting in low strength of the green body after molding
[0007] In addition, the existing technical process of permeable bricks is relatively complicated, with many production processes, long time consumption and high cost. The process flow chart is as follows figure 1 shown
see figure 1 , the binder of the existing permeable bricks requires a separate ball mill, but the ball milling process takes a long time to operate, the ball milling equipment is bulky and occupies a large area, which will greatly increase the production cost of the permeable bricks

Abstract

The invention discloses a sintered water permeable brick produced by using furnace slag. The sintered water permeable brick comprises a surface material and a bottom material, wherein the bottom material is prepared from the following main raw materials in parts by mass: 80-100 parts of furnace slag, 3-12 parts of bonding base material and 3-12 parts of liquid glue; and the surface material is prepared from the following main raw materials in parts by mass: 0-30 parts of furnace slag, 0-4 parts of bonding base material, 0-4 parts of liquid glue and 0-4 parts of pigment; the bonding base material is one or more of bentonite and clay; and the liquid glue is one or more of a silica sol solution, a polyacrylamide solution and a guar gum solution. Correspondingly, the invention discloses a preparation method of the sintered water permeable brick produced by using furnace slag. The water permeable brick prepared from the furnace slag serving as the main raw material in the preparation methodis high in strength, strong in freezing resistance and excellent in water permeability.

Description

technical field [0001] The invention relates to the technical field of permeable bricks, in particular to a sintered permeable brick produced by using slag and a preparation method thereof. Background technique [0002] Permeable bricks are a new century-old environmentally friendly building material that was born to alleviate urban waterlogging, maintain water, maintain urban ecological balance and build a sponge city. It uses waste ceramic tiles (waste polished tiles, waste polished glazed tiles, waste tiles, etc.), slag, slag and other solid waste as the main raw materials, together with forming aids, adding an appropriate amount of binder, after two times of cloth molding, high temperature Burning is a green environmental protection product. [0003] Permeable bricks can consume a large amount of waste tiles (solid waste such as slag or slag), which not only solves the problem of solid waste treatment at this stage, but also greatly reduces environmental pollution.
